No it's way better then just .htaccess. Standard Apache Rewrite Module that you use to protect images cannot protect movies, since movie players do not pass referrers and you have to allow visitors without referrer information, thus leaving your movie files open for hotlinkers. Use of cookie based protection fails since there are plenty of visitors that turn off that feature in their browser settings. You also have to include a Java Script on all your pages to use this feature and it creates problems with people who turn off Java Scripts in their browsers as well. I ran into all of these problems until we went with AHL. What different about AHL is it's an intelligent program running on the server configured with Apache. It monitors all file requests and the ones that come directly for movies are blocked. If they follow the right pattern on coming into your site first, looking at a page then they can access the movies. Zagi, the Java / cookies method added to your existing .htaccess hotlink protection does not work and I proved it. We removed it from our site and our sales shot up 40%. So what does that tell you? It's old out of date technology.. Too many people now a days are net savvy and are using programs that kill cookies and java. With the method you pointed out if there browser does not fully cooperate by first allowing java to run to set the cookie and for the computer to accept the cookie and send it back they will end up getting just a general error in media player. They will not know why and will think your site is at fault... there goes that sale! See how costly this can be?
